Daitoku-ji Temple
Daitoku-ji is a vast temple complex comprising 24 sub-temples and serves as the headquarters of the Rinzai school of Zen Buddhism. It's considered one of the best places in Japan to experience Zen culture and Japanese rock gardens. Four sub-temples are open year-round: Daisen-in with its famous rock garden, Zuiho-in, Ryogen-in, and Koto-in. The complex is less crowded than other famous temples, allowing for a truly meditative experience.
